I really don’t mind living here, but something to know is that the Women’s Premium building isn’t really better than the standard men’s building, the 3rd floor of which was for women last semester. The premium is slightly larger in sq feet I think, I get my own desk now, and one of the bathrooms is extra large, but those are tiny conveniences, and I’m having a lot of problems with this apartment that I didn’t have in the standard ones last semester. Like there’s holes in my blinds (1st floor btw), my bedroom door gets stuck when it’s closing, and I’m pretty sure we have a leak in my room as well which has left a wet spot in the carpet. Also I’m pretty sure there are bits of mold on the ceiling, and the amount of storage space is very minimal. Most of these are small annoyances but I mostly can’t believe I was charged more for this, even if it was just a little extra lol
